diff options
author | Sarah Groff Hennigh-Palermo <sarah.groff.palermo@gmail.com> | 2019-05-20 17:08:37 +0000 |
---|---|---|
committer | Fatih Acet <acetfatih@gmail.com> | 2019-05-20 17:08:37 +0000 |
commit | 68fd2bdd74f675f66e39d8785541e85b56ca54ce (patch) | |
tree | 3b23e172b624ce603391c04380b1b2e86a7d34c2 /spec | |
parent | 24c496581fb9fdb72fb4ca2465efaaeca0b65c54 (diff) | |
download | gitlab-ce-68fd2bdd74f675f66e39d8785541e85b56ca54ce.tar.gz |
Add backport changes
Adds backport changes for ee
Diffstat (limited to 'spec')
-rw-r--r-- | spec/javascripts/vue_mr_widget/components/mr_widget_pipeline_container_spec.js | 4 | ||||
-rw-r--r-- | spec/javascripts/vue_mr_widget/mock_data.js | 37 |
2 files changed, 37 insertions, 4 deletions
diff --git a/spec/javascripts/vue_mr_widget/components/mr_widget_pipeline_container_spec.js b/spec/javascripts/vue_mr_widget/components/mr_widget_pipeline_container_spec.js index e5155573f6f..dfbc68c48b9 100644 --- a/spec/javascripts/vue_mr_widget/components/mr_widget_pipeline_container_spec.js +++ b/spec/javascripts/vue_mr_widget/components/mr_widget_pipeline_container_spec.js @@ -1,4 +1,4 @@ -import { shallowMount, createLocalVue } from '@vue/test-utils'; +import { mount, createLocalVue } from '@vue/test-utils'; import MrWidgetPipelineContainer from '~/vue_merge_request_widget/components/mr_widget_pipeline_container.vue'; import MrWidgetPipeline from '~/vue_merge_request_widget/components/mr_widget_pipeline.vue'; import { mockStore } from '../mock_data'; @@ -9,7 +9,7 @@ describe('MrWidgetPipelineContainer', () => { const factory = (props = {}) => { const localVue = createLocalVue(); - wrapper = shallowMount(localVue.extend(MrWidgetPipelineContainer), { + wrapper = mount(localVue.extend(MrWidgetPipelineContainer), { propsData: { mr: Object.assign({}, mockStore), ...props, diff --git a/spec/javascripts/vue_mr_widget/mock_data.js b/spec/javascripts/vue_mr_widget/mock_data.js index dda16375103..bec16b0aab0 100644 --- a/spec/javascripts/vue_mr_widget/mock_data.js +++ b/spec/javascripts/vue_mr_widget/mock_data.js @@ -235,11 +235,44 @@ export default { troubleshooting_docs_path: 'help', merge_request_pipelines_docs_path: '/help/ci/merge_request_pipelines/index.md', squash: true, + visual_review_app_available: true, }; export const mockStore = { - pipeline: { id: 0 }, - mergePipeline: { id: 1 }, + pipeline: { + id: 0, + details: { + status: { + details_path: '/root/review-app-tester/pipelines/66', + favicon: + '/assets/ci_favicons/favicon_status_success-8451333011eee8ce9f2ab25dc487fe24a8758c694827a582f17f42b0a90446a2. png', + group: 'success-with-warnings', + has_details: true, + icon: 'status_warning', + illustration: null, + label: 'passed with warnings', + text: 'passed', + tooltip: 'passed', + }, + }, + }, + mergePipeline: { + id: 1, + details: { + status: { + details_path: '/root/review-app-tester/pipelines/66', + favicon: + '/assets/ci_favicons/favicon_status_success-8451333011eee8ce9f2ab25dc487fe24a8758c694827a582f17f42b0a90446a2. png', + group: 'success-with-warnings', + has_details: true, + icon: 'status_warning', + illustration: null, + label: 'passed with warnings', + text: 'passed', + tooltip: 'passed', + }, + }, + }, targetBranch: 'target-branch', sourceBranch: 'source-branch', sourceBranchLink: 'source-branch-link', |